University of Catania Fund for Research FIR14 – Military Humanitarian Operations at a Crossroad? The Mare Nostrum Operation: the Expert’s Assessment and Lessons Learned

Principal Investigator Fulvio Attinà

This Project has four research lines:

  1. The inter-disciplinary analysis of the “Mare Nostrum” Operation data, records and actions.
  2. The survey of experts’ evaluation about the goals, actions and outcomes of the Operations.
  3. The definition of lessons learned from the Operation by adding the empirical analysis findings and the experts’ evaluation outputs.
  4. The advancement of scientific and policy knowledge about military humanitarian operations. This part aims especially at giving advisement to policy-makers about same and alike operations in a future crisis.
